1885 Patrick Canning and Sarah McGee were married on Friday, November 6, at St Paul's R.C. Church, Shettleston after Publication according to the Forms of the Roman Catholic Church. The marriage was registered No.63 at Shettleston on November 9.
Patrick was a Bachelor, gave his age as 26, occupation Coal Miner and usual residence 28 Baillies Causeway, Hamilton. His parents are recorded as Patrick Canning, Coal Miner and Rose Canning m.s. Barr (deceased).
Sarah was a Spinster, gave her age as 22 [she was nearer 24 if I've got this right], occupation Bleacher and usual residence Main Street, Tollcross. Her parents are recorded as John McGee, Labourer and Rose McGee m.s. Gallacher.
The celebrant was Fr Joseph Van Hecke and the witnesses were James McGee [her cousin?] & Catherine McGee [her sister? or her 14-year-old cousin?] who made "her X mark".
[A Hanah Canning was sponsor at the baptism of Sarah's cousin Catherine in October 1871.]
